This paper studies management and coordination problems of electric vehicle battery supply chain based on old for new selling strategies. Closed-loop supply chain is widely applied in electric vehicle remanufacturable battery industry. Two channels of battery recycling are considered, which are recycling station channel and retailer channel. Recycling battery in recycling station channel is discarded battery, which is low value and high cost to remanufacturing, while recycling battery in retailer channel is used battery, which is good condition and low cost to remanufacturing but high collecting cost. The mathematical models based on Stackelberg model are established and prove that the old for new selling strategies is Pareto improvement, which increase profit both of supplier and retailer and enlarge the scale of market.
